Back from the soldier ride

Well we finished Sat with the ride around Corpus Christi, what a great experience. I logged 459.8 miles, but I rode with the soldiers the 108 mile day and only got 25 miles so some of the team were well over the 500 mile mark in 8 days. Our blog is not complete yet but there is a lot of it up there (see button in sig line) We are already talking about a repeat next year, but I am voting for more hotels, less camping. More because we could get some of the wounded warriors to ride than anything else. Not to mention about half way through day 2 (150 miles in) I was beat and thanks to my dad changing from riding to sag I dropped most of my weight off the bike to be able to continue. Learned a lot about what to pack, and how, now just got to get it all together for my next adventure.
